DescriptionRiverside Exchange is an attractive waterfront mixed use development. It is also a strategic site in terms of the South Yorkshire conurbation andhas Objective One status for European Grant Aid.
The riverside scheme adjacent to the heart of the city comprises a mixture of offices, including the refurbishment of a former brewery building,residential apartments and a 525 space multi-storey car park. Existing high-profile occupiers include law firm, Irwin Mitchell and the Home Office.
• Current occupied offices offering c.200,000sq.ft over four buildings, including asympathetically redeveloped brewery. Let toIrwin Mitchell and the Home Office.
• Final office development phase offering from 40,000 to 239,355 sq.ft, depending onoccupiers requirements(see overleaf for more details)
• 214 luxury residential apartments • 525 space multi-storey car park• Retail/ leisure units

‘Indicative’ specification for Single Office scheme
...A unique opportunity to create a significant HQ building of up toc.240,000 sq.ft on this strategic 9 acre site which currently compriseshigh profile office occupiers, luxury residential apartments and retail/leisure overlooking the River Don...
Building features include:
• Feature glazing to the riverside walk elevation
• Large spans provided by the structural grid of c.9 x 8mallow columns to be widely dispersed, allowing flexiblespace planning
• Glazed roofs to the atria allow natural light to penetratethe building
• Internal glass balustrading along the perimeter of thefloor voids forming the atria maximise their effect as‘lightwells’ within the building
• 2.7m floor to ceiling heights
• 225mm raised floor zone providing approx. 200mmservice void
• 9no. 13 person lifts
• Air conditioning (VRF Heating and Cooling system)
• 274 car parking spaces in the adjacent multi-storey car park

LocationRiverside Exchange sits alongside the River Don, next to the City's law courts and on the fringe of the principal retail areas of the city centre. In the heart of the business district, the site is accessible to the Sheffield Parkway (A57/A630) linking to the Airport and M1 motorway atJunction 33. Riverside Exchange lies within walking distance of the facilities of the city centre including retail, restaurant and leisure and is wellplaced for public transport including the Supertram on High Street, the central bus station and the railway station with its inter-city services.

SheffieldThe country's 4th largest provincial city boasts a districtpopulation in excess of 700,000 and two highly-rateduniversities with over 40,000 students. Sheffield is a city onthe move, whose traditional internationally renownedmanufacturing base is being bolstered by significant growthin financial, media and technology industries.
